// IsMountNotFoundError returns true if error is a mount not found error.
func IsMountNotFoundError(err error) bool {
var respErr *api.ResponseError
if errors.As(err, &respErr) && respErr != nil {
if respErr.StatusCode == http.StatusNotFound {
return true
}
if respErr.StatusCode == http.StatusBadRequest {
for _, e := range respErr.Errors {
if strings.Contains(e, VaultSecretMountNotFoundErrMsg) {
return true
}
if strings.Contains(e, VaultAuthMountNotFoundErrMsg) {
return true
}
}
}
}

if errors.Is(err, ErrMountNotFound) {
return true
}

return false
}
